Job description

Description

Action Industries, manufacturer and distributor of garage door parts is seeking an energetic, detail-oriented Buyer.

Summary

As a Buyer, you will be responsible for assisting with the procurement process, including contract management, contract negotiation and preparation of purchase orders. You will also be responsible for ensuring that our commitments to customers are met.

Responsibilities
  • Perform purchasing process according to commodity methods assigned (visual tools, SAP, Etc); maintain inventory levels.
  • Place, confirm and track orders, follow-up on late orders.
  • Obtain quotes for purchase of non-standard items.
  • Managing and maintaining contracts with vendors.
  • Update and maintain supplier data in SAP.
  • Administer contracts, control costs, and ensure on-time delivery in accordance with program requirements.
  • Negotiating and drafting contract terms and conditions.
  • Ensuring compliance with all related laws and regulations.
  • Analyzing and evaluating supplier performance.
  • Managing daily, monthly and quarterly reports.
  • Developing and maintaining supplier relationships.
  • Coordinating with other departments.
  • Create and execute Purchase Orders.
  • Manage quality, design and payment to vendors.
  • Monitor special promotions to assure appropriate inventory levels.
  • Monitor customer specific stock items to look for changes in purchasing patterns. Follow up with the procurement team and sales with data.
  • Process accounts payable, reconciling invoices with purchase order.
  • Identify inventory discrepancies and communicate with appropriate personnel.
  • Prepare various daily, weekly and monthly reports.
  • Be mindful of landed costs and utilize department policies by actively controlling freight costs by our strategic plan.
  • Assist with market analysis to determine supplier sources and product availability; keep abreast of market fluctuations and advise appropriate staff.
  • Work as a team to review stock levels, history, vendor performance and discuss and recommend changes to the procurement team.
  • Work as a cross functional team to emulate the Core Values within our daily work.
  • Other duties as assigned.
Education & Experience
  • 3-5 years of experience in buyer or procurement role.
  • Supply Chain degree preferred, or a few years of experience in lieu of a degree.
Core Competencies
  • Organizational skills; ability to multi-task.
  • Demonstrated attention to detail.
  • Build positive, collaborative relationships.
  • Communicate clearly and professionally.
Requirements
  • Basic understanding of inventory control.
  • Interpersonal skills: demonstrated ability to establish and maintain effective work relationships both internally and externally.
  • Analytical skills.
  • Demonstrated ability to negotiate with vendors.
  • Experience with Microsoft Office suite of products including Outlook, Teams, Word, and Excel.
  • Experience with an ERP system, (SAP preferred).
  • Proactive attitude towards work, teamwork, and cooperation.
